Rose, Ellen – Educational Technology, 1999
Examines the term interactivity as it is used in educational computing, and suggests that by applying deconstructive criticism new perspectives may be gained. Discusses learner control, non-linearity, and flexibility, and concludes that interactivity is not a conceptual unity. (LRW)
